Sit-In-Protest at Imphal on Coalgate and 2G Spectrum scams by BJP



Sit-in-Protest cum Dharna being organised by BJP, Manipur Pradesh in presence with Shri Tapir Gao, National General Secretary, BJP at Imphal on 4th May, 2013 from 12 Noon to 4 PM. Around 2540 party workers, leaders and sympathizers from across the valley districts of Manipur attended the programme (enclosed as attach file). The programme was a grand success. The same programme will also be organised at Khangabok Bazar, Khangabok A/C, the assembly constituency of Chief Minister O. Ibobi Singh on 5th May, 2013 from 12 Noon to 4 PM. The memorandum was submitted to the Hon'ble Governor of Manipur by a team of State Office bearers led by the undersigned on 4th May, 2013.

The Bharatiya Janata party, Manipur Pradesh wishes to draw your kind attention to the scams of Coalgate and 2G Spectrum.

On 28th June, 2004, the UPA-government conceived the “Competitive-bidding” of 142 Coal-blocks. From 2004 to 2009, Shri Manmohan Singh as the Prime Minister of India held the portfolio of Coal, during which the appended sanctions to families and relatives of the UPA-Ministers and also to private entrepreneurs and traders who were in fact not the end-users.

On 31st May, 2012 BJP made a complaint to the Central Vigilance Commissioner and consequently the Central Bureau of Investigation (CBI) intervened to investigate into the irregularities of the Coal-block-allocation. Later, in September, 2012, the Supreme Court took cognizance of a Public Interest Litigation and directed the CBI to submit an affidavit on the status of Coalgate-issue without consulting with any authority.

On 26th April, 2013, the CBI-Director, admitting that the draft-report had been shared with the Law Minister and Joint Secretaries of the Prime Minister’s Office and Coal Ministry, as compelled by the Government, submitted the affidavit. Seemingly the Law Ministry tampered the CBI report and acted as a “human shield” to protect the PM from the scam worth Rs. 1.86 lakh crores. The Apex Court, however, advice to submit a clean affidavit by 6th May, 2013 for the sitting of the court on 8th May, 2013. Harin Raval, the Additional Solicitor General of Law Ministry who happened to be the counsel of CBI resigned, on being a scapegoat in writing a letter to the Apex Court maintaining the sharing of the draft report with none.

On 2nd November, 2007, the PM, in his letter to the Telecom Minister (TM), questioned the letter about the fairness of 2G Spectrum allotments. Even after learning the flaws in the allotment from the reply of the Telecom Minister, the PM allowed the TM to sustain allotment in whatever the ways by arbitrarily changing the cut-off-dates, permitting the ineligible companies and applying the 2001-rate. On 26th October, 2009, in his public statement the PM asserted that false allegations were made against the TM whom the CBI had already registered a case on the relevant issue.

After the intervention of the Apex Court and consequent arrest of the TM, the TM started spilling the beans saying that the context whatsoever was in the knowledge of the PM. The TM himself and other members of the Joint Parliamentary Committee (JPC) wanted the TM to appear before the JPC which the PM had already claimed to be the institution to probe the scam. Despite the request, the TM was not permitted on the presumption that he might speak out all the facts. The PM eluded the JPC at the same time when the JPC did not call upon the PM with an intent to skirt the JPC meeting on the agendum.

By humiliating the sanctity of the JPC, the PM got himself exonerated from 2G Scam worth Rs. 1.76 lakh crores taking resort to an instrument in the form of a report made by P.C. Chacko, the JPC Chief. Astonishingly, Chacko alleged Shri Atal Biharai Vajpayeeji to have led to the loss of Rs. 40,000 crores in allocation of Spectrum-licences during his tenure. The Congress government tried to suppress the misdeeds of Shri Manmohan Singh and despite, Shri Atalji, one of the finest Prime Ministers in post-independent India was unnecessarily put at stake. For such acts of dishonesty and maladministration and also for betraying the Parliament, the people and the nation, BJP strongly demands the removal of the Law Minister and the resignation of the Prime Minister.
